WebExample: What is the derivative of x 2 +x 3 ? The Sum Rule says: the derivative of f + g = f’ + g’ So we can work out each derivative separately and then add them. Using the … WebDec 23, 2024 · By the facts, the derivative of 2 is 0. To find the derivative of x, we can think of it as x1 and use our fact. Thus, the derivative of x is 1 * x1-1 = x0 = 1. Transcribed image text: Find the derivative with respect tox f (x,y) = x32xy. rcs9621WebAn antiderivative of function f (x) is a function whose derivative is equal to f (x). Is integral the same as antiderivative? The set of all antiderivatives of a function is the indefinite integral of the function.
